| Http :: oai :: repository HTTP :: OAI :: Repository is een documentatie voor het bouwen van een OAI-compatibele repository met behulp van OAI-PERL. |
Download nu |
Http :: oai :: repository Rangschikking & Samenvatting
- Vergunning:
- Perl Artistic License
- Naam uitgever:
- HTTP::OAI::Repository Team
- Uitgever website:
- http://search.cpan.org/~timbrody/HTTP-OAI-3.18/lib/HTTP/OAI/Repository.pm
Http :: oai :: repository Tags
Http :: oai :: repository Beschrijving
Http :: OAI :: Repository is een documentatie voor het bouwen van een OAI-compatibele repository met behulp van OAI-PERL. Http :: OAI :: Repository is een documentatie voor het bouwen van een OAI-conforme repository met OAI-PERL.USING De OAI-PERL-bibliotheek in een repository-context vereist dat de gebruiker de OAI-reacties op OAI-reacties wordt verzonden. Synopsis Gebruik http: : OAI :: Harvester; Gebruik http :: oai :: metadata :: oai_dc; Gebruik XML :: SAX :: Writer; Gebruik XML :: LIBXML; # (Al deze opties _must_ worden geleverd om te voldoen aan het OAI-protocol) # (protocolveren en responsedate beide hebben een verstandige standaardwaarden) Mijn $ R = NIEUW HTTP :: OAI :: Identify (BASEURL => 'HTTP: // YEHOST / CGI / OAI ', adminemail =>' youmail @ yourhost ', repositoryname =>' AGOODNAME ', REAGEURL => Self_url ()); # Omvat een beschrijving (een XML :: Libxml DOM-object) $ R-> Beschrijving (NIEUWE http :: OAI :: METADATA (DOM => $ DOM)); Mijn $ r = http :: oai :: getrecord-> nieuw (header => http :: oai :: header-> nieuw (identifier => 'oai: myrepo: 10', datestamp => '2004-10-01' ), METADATA => HTTP :: OAI :: METADATA :: OAI_DC-> NIEUW (DC => {titel => , Beschrijving => }); $ r-> over (http :: oai :: metadata-> nieuw (dom => $ dom)); Mijn $ Writer = XML :: Sax :: Writer-> Nieuw (); $ r-> set_handler ($ schrijver); $ r-> genereren; vereisten: · perl
Http :: oai :: repository Gerelateerde software